Nautical miles Definition
A nautical mile is a unit of measurement used primarily in maritime and air navigation. It is based on the circumference of the Earth and is equivalent to one minute of latitude. One nautical mile is approximately 1.15078 miles or 1.852 kilometers, making it particularly useful for navigation over large distances.
How to Convert 650 ft to Nautical miles
To convert feet to nautical miles, you can use the following formula:
1 nautical mile = 6076.12 feet
To convert 650 feet to nautical miles, divide the number of feet by the number of feet in a nautical mile:
650 ft ÷ 6076.12 ft/nautical mile ≈ 0.107 nautical miles.
This means that 650 feet is approximately 0.107 nautical miles.
